The district attorney for Pointe Coupee Parish will not recuse himself from a drunk driving case despite knowing the suspect's family well.
Terri Parker's family filed a formal request last week to have Ricky Ward removed from the case.
Parker died last month after investigators say a car she was riding in was hit by another vehicle driven by Victoria Gosserand. According to investigators, Gosserand's blood-alcohol level was three times the legal limit.
After reviewing the request by Parker's family, Ward told News 2 he chose not to remove his office from the case because he has not received the same request from the other crash victim who survived.
The case goes before a grand jury next month.
